Clustered vs non-clustered index sql server
WebJan 30, 2013 · Viewed 60k times 5 I am working on various query optimization techniques. I reduced the query execution time from 1 minute to 12 seconds just by adding a Non-Clustered-Index on a table including one column (which is used in multiple where conditions) but DBA is very picky about adding indexes. WebMar 17, 2024 · I was recently scolded for suggesting that, in some cases, a non-clustered index will perform better for a particular query than the clustered index. This person stated that the clustered index is always …
Clustered vs non-clustered index sql server
Did you know?
WebOct 12, 2024 · SQL Server Nonclustered Indexes. A nonclustered index is a smaller set of data, index columns, stored separately and ordered based on the definition of the … WebFeb 28, 2024 · You can create clustered indexes on tables by using SQL Server Management Studio or Transact-SQL. With few exceptions, every table should have a clustered index. Besides improving query performance, a clustered index can be rebuilt or reorganized on demand to control table fragmentation. A clustered index can also be …
WebSep 26, 2024 · There are a few differences between a clustered index and a non-clustered index. A clustered index impacts how data is stored in a table. Only one clustered index can exist on a table, but you can have … WebApr 12, 2024 · Clustered vs non-clustered indices behind the scenes. Lets start with answering the question “What is an Index?”— In general, an index is a system or tool …
WebSep 26, 2024 · Clustered and Non-Clustered Indexes in SQL Server What is the Difference Between a Clustered and Non-Clustered Index? Example: Clustered Index Example: Non-Clustered Index A Quick Overview of All the Other SQL Index Types Understand All the Different Ways Indexes are Used in Queries How to Make Changes … WebJan 21, 2024 · Clustered and non-clustered indexes are the two main types of indexes in SQL Server. Both types serve the same purpose, but they work in different ways and have different use cases. Clustered Indexes
Web1 Answer Sorted by: 12 Because the majority of the table fits the criteria for the first query, so it is more efficient to scan the clustered index rather than do key lookups for each of the rows that match the criteria. Key lookups …
WebJan 5, 2024 · A clustered index may be the fastest for one SELECT statement but it may not necessarily be correct choice. SQL Server indices are b-trees. A non-clustered index just contains the indexed columns, with the leaf nodes of the b-tree being pointers to the approprate data page. A clustered index is different: its leaf nodes are the data page itself. permit to leave buildingWebMay 18, 2024 · A non-clustered index is an index with a key and a pointer to the rows or the clustered index keys. This index can apply to both tables and views. Unlike clustered indexes, here the structure is separate … permit to fill in poolWebAug 18, 2013 · But only if you pick a good clustered index. It's the most replicated data structure in your SQL Server database. The clustering key will be part of each and every … permit to grow marijuana in californiaWebSep 7, 2024 · Clustered indexes sort and store the data rows in the table or view based on their key values. Clustered indexes sort the records and store them physically according to the order. Data retrieval is faster than non-clustered indexes. Clustered indexes do not consume extra space. Non-clustered index permit to light fire queenslandWebMar 26, 2024 · The main difference between clustered and non-clustered indexes is that a table can have only one clustered index, which determines the physical order of data in the table, while it can have multiple non-clustered indexes that don’t affect the physical order of data. Q: When should you use a clustered index? permit to fly aircraftWebMar 3, 2024 · Right-click the table on which you want to create a nonclustered index and select Design. Right-click on the column you want to create the nonclustered index on … permit to legally perform certain tasksWebApr 2, 2024 · A clustered index is a special type of index that determines the physical order of the rows in a table. It sorts the data by one or more columns, called the … permit to leave greater sydney